I’ve always found store-bought sweet chili sauce a bit thin and overly sweet, which is why I created this flavor-packed homemade version. Say goodbye to bland store-bought sauces and hello to this flavor-packed homemade sweet chili recipe. We’re skipping the basic sugar-and-chili combination in favor of something richer, using fire-roasted red peppers and a hint of smoked paprika to create depth of flavor. The aroma alone when you roast those peppers is incredible. This recipe is incredibly versatile, perfect for dipping family favorites like spring rolls or adding a sweet heat to stir-fries, making it perfect for healthy, easy dinner ideas. It’s surprisingly easy to make a big batch for the week, and the flavor only improves overnight. Get ready for a sweet chili sauce that delivers savory complexity alongside its heat and sweetness.

Ingredients
- 2 large red bell peppers (approx. 400g)
We use bell peppers as the base for this recipe, rather than just water, to give it a richer body and natural sweetness. Roasting them caramelizes the sugars, intensifying the flavor and creating a smoky backbone that sets this sauce apart. Look for firm, bright red peppers without blemishes for the best results. - 3-5 fresh red chilies, finely minced
The primary source of heat; adjust the quantity to your preferred spice level. For a milder sauce, use fewer chilies or remove the seeds and membranes before mincing (this removes most of the capsaicin). For a kid-friendly version, you can reduce this significantly or replace with a pinch of red pepper flakes for visual texture. - 4-5 cloves garlic, minced
Garlic adds a sharp, aromatic quality that balances the sweetness and chili heat. Minced garlic integrates best into the sauce base; avoid finely grated garlic, which can sometimes burn or become bitter during simmering. Fresh garlic cloves are essential for this recipe; powdered garlic will not provide the same depth of flavor. - 150g (3/4 cup) granulated sugar
Provides the classic sweetness that defines sweet chili sauce. Granulated sugar dissolves easily, creating a smooth, glossy texture. For an alternative, you can try substituting honey or brown sugar, though this will change the flavor profile and color. - 120ml (1/2 cup) rice vinegar
The acidity from the rice vinegar balances the sweetness of the sugar and peppers. Rice vinegar offers a milder, slightly sweet tang compared to distilled white vinegar. Do not substitute apple cider vinegar, as its flavor profile is too strong for this recipe. - 120ml (1/2 cup) water, plus 60ml (1/4 cup) for blending, plus 30ml (2 tbsp) for cornstarch slurry
Used for thinning the sauce base to the right consistency and creating the slurry for thickening. Use filtered water for the cleanest taste. The different measurements are for specific steps: blending the peppers, simmering the sauce, and mixing the slurry. - 15ml (1 tbsp) light soy sauce
Adds a vital layer of umami and saltiness that deepens the flavor profile beyond just sweet and spicy. Use light soy sauce to avoid overpowering the sauce with too much salt or dark color. For a gluten-free alternative, Tamari works perfectly; for a low-sodium version, use low-sodium soy sauce. - 5g (1 tsp) smoked paprika
This is the secret ingredient that provides the smoky notes. Use sweet smoked paprika (pimentón dulce) for a less intense flavor. Do not substitute regular paprika; it lacks the smoky character needed for this recipe. - 2g (1/2 tsp) fine sea salt
Enhances all the other flavors in the sauce, particularly the sweetness. Adjust according to taste after the sauce has thickened. Start with a small amount, as the soy sauce also adds significant sodium. - 15g (1 tbsp) cornstarch
A necessary thickening agent to give the sweet chili recipe sauce a glossy, clingy texture. Cornstarch slurry prevents lumps and ensures the sauce thickens consistently. Do not add dry cornstarch directly to the hot liquid, as it will clump immediately. - 15g (1/4 cup) fresh cilantro, finely chopped, for garnish
Adds a fresh, bright flavor and color contrast to the finished sauce. Use fresh cilantro only; dried cilantro will not provide the same aromatic lift. Garnish immediately before serving for best results.
Instructions
- Prepare the Roasted Red Peppers: Preheat your oven to 200°C (400°F) to ensure even roasting. Place the red bell peppers on a baking sheet and roast for 20-25 minutes, or until the skins are visibly blistered and slightly charred, and the flesh underneath feels very soft when pressed. Transfer the hot peppers to a bowl immediately, cover tightly with plastic wrap, and let them steam for 10-15 minutes; this makes the skin incredibly easy to peel. Once cool enough to handle, peel off the skin, remove the stems and seeds, and roughly chop the flesh.
- Blend the Puree: In a blender, combine the roasted red pepper flesh with 60ml (1/4 cup) of water. Blend until the mixture is completely smooth and free of large pieces, scraping down the sides as necessary to incorporate everything. This creates the vibrant red pepper puree that forms the base of our sweet chili sauce.
- Simmer the Sauce Base: In a medium saucepan, combine the red pepper puree, the remaining 120ml (1/2 cup) of water, rice vinegar, granulated sugar, light soy sauce, smoked paprika, and fine sea salt. Bring the mixture to a gentle simmer over medium heat, stirring continuously until the granulated sugar is fully dissolved. Keep the heat moderate; a gentle simmer is sufficient to dissolve the sugar without burning the base.
- Add Aromatics and Flavor: Add the finely minced fresh red chilies and minced garlic to the simmering sweet chili recipe sauce. Reduce the heat to low and continue to simmer for 5 minutes, allowing the flavors to meld and infuse into the sauce base. Adding the garlic and chilies after the initial simmer preserves more of their fresh, pungent flavor compared to adding them at the beginning.
- Thicken the Sauce: In a small bowl, whisk together the cornstarch with the 30ml (2 tbsp) of cold water until a smooth slurry forms, ensuring there are no lumps. Slowly pour the cornstarch slurry into the simmering sauce while continuously whisking to distribute it evenly and prevent clumping. Increase the heat slightly to medium-low and cook, stirring constantly, for 2-3 minutes, or until the sweet chili recipe sauce thickens and becomes glossy. If your sauce thickens too quickly and becomes gloopy, whisk in an additional tablespoon of water or rice vinegar to smooth it out.
- Finish and Serve: Remove the sauce from the heat and let it cool slightly before serving. The sauce will thicken further as it cools; a hot sauce will be much thinner than a cold one. Serve warm or at room temperature, garnished with fresh cilantro as described.
Serving Suggestions and Variations
This homemade sweet chili recipe offers more depth than the store-bought versions, making it versatile beyond basic dipping. The smoky note from the roasted red peppers makes it a perfect pairing for many easy dinner ideas and high-protein snacks.
- For dipping: This sauce pairs perfectly with classic Asian appetizers like homemade spring rolls, potstickers, or crispy wontons. The smoky note also makes it ideal for dipping chicken nuggets, tenders, or grilled shrimp skewers. I personally love using this sweet chili recipe as a glaze on grilled chicken thighs for a quick family dinner.
- As a glaze or marinade: Brush the sweet chili recipe sauce over chicken wings or salmon fillets during the last few minutes of cooking for a glossy finish. It also makes a fantastic marinade for grilled tofu or vegetables.
- Stir-fry base: Use this sauce as a base for a quick family stir-fry. Add vegetables, protein, and a couple tablespoons of the sauce for a flavorful coating. You may need to thin it with a little water or chicken stock depending on the stir-fry volume.
- Heat customization: Adjust the heat level by adding more or fewer fresh chilies during step 4. For a very mild sweet chili recipe suitable for kids, use only a few small chilies or omit them entirely. For extra heat, add a pinch of cayenne pepper during the simmering process.

Make-Ahead Tips and Storage
This recipe is ideal for making a large batch and storing for future use. The flavor deepens and improves significantly after sitting overnight, making it perfect for meal prep recipes.
- Batch cooking: This sweet chili recipe is ideal for making a large batch. It’s one of my go-to methods for easy healthy eating throughout the week.
- Refrigeration: Store the sauce in an airtight container or jar in the refrigerator for up to 2 weeks. Ensure the container is clean before filling to maximize shelf life.
- Freezing instructions: For long-term storage, transfer cooled sauce to freezer-safe bags or containers (leaving some headspace for expansion). Freeze for up to 3 months. Thaw overnight in the refrigerator before use. Reheat gently on the stovetop or in the microwave.
FAQs
Can I use dried red pepper flakes instead of fresh chilies?
Yes, for a quick substitute, you can use dried red pepper flakes. Start with 1 teaspoon and add more to taste. Note that dried flakes will give a different kind of heat and won’t contribute the fresh flavor of real chilies to this sweet chili recipe.
How do I adjust the thickness of the sweet chili recipe sauce?
If the sauce is too thick, thin it with a tablespoon of water or rice vinegar at a time until you reach the desired consistency. If it’s too thin, create another small cornstarch slurry (1 tsp cornstarch mixed with 1 tbsp cold water) and slowly whisk it into the simmering sweet chili recipe sauce.
Is this sweet chili recipe gluten-free?
Yes, this recipe is naturally gluten-free if you use Tamari instead of traditional light soy sauce. Ensure all other ingredients, like rice vinegar, are certified gluten-free if necessary, especially if you’re sensitive to cross-contamination.
Can I use a different kind of sugar?
You can use brown sugar, but it will create a darker sauce with a slightly different flavor profile (more caramel notes). Honey can also be used, but start with slightly less than the amount of granulated sugar, as honey is generally sweeter.
How can I make this sweet chili recipe low-carb?
You can easily make this sweet chili recipe suitable for low-carb meals by swapping the granulated sugar for a sugar substitute like erythritol or monk fruit sweetener. Use a 1:1 ratio for a start, then adjust to taste since sweetener intensity can vary.
How do I make this sauce even better for dipping?
I find that a quick squeeze of fresh lime juice right after taking the sauce off the heat brightens all the flavors significantly. It adds a final zing that cuts through the richness and sweetness of this sweet chili recipe.
Conclusion
This homemade sweet chili recipe elevates a pantry staple with a smoky, roasted flavor profile that goes beyond standard sauces. It’s perfect for creating quick meals and family dinners with a gourmet touch. If you love this recipe, consider saving it on Pinterest to revisit for future meal prep!
Print
sweet chili recipe
- Total Time: 50 minutes
- Yield: 16 servings 1x
- Diet: General
Description
This homemade sweet chili sauce offers a richer, more complex flavor than store-bought versions by using fire-roasted red peppers and smoked paprika. It balances sweetness, heat, and savory notes, making it versatile for dipping or as a stir-fry base.
Ingredients
- 2 large red bell peppers
- 3–5 fresh red chilies, minced
- 4–5 cloves garlic, minced
- 0.75 cup granulated sugar
- 0.5 cup rice vinegar
- 1 cup water, divided
- 1 tablespoon light soy sauce
- 1 teaspoon smoked paprika
- 0.5 teaspoon fine sea salt
- 1 tablespoon cornstarch
- 0.25 cup fresh cilantro, chopped (for garnish)
Instructions
- Roast Peppers: Preheat oven to 400°F (200°C). Roast peppers for 20-25 minutes until skins blistered. Transfer hot peppers to a covered bowl and steam for 10-15 minutes. Once cool, peel off skin, remove seeds and stem, and roughly chop the flesh.
- Blend Puree: Place chopped pepper flesh and 0.25 cup water in a blender. Blend until completely smooth.
- Simmer Sauce Base: Combine pepper puree with 0.5 cup water, rice vinegar, sugar, soy sauce, paprika, and salt in a medium saucepan. Bring to a gentle simmer over medium heat, stirring until sugar dissolves.
- Add Aromatics: Add minced chilies and garlic. Reduce heat to low and simmer for 5 minutes to infuse flavors.
- Thicken Sauce: Whisk cornstarch with 2 tablespoons cold water to create a slurry. Slowly whisk the slurry into the simmering sauce. Increase heat to medium-low and cook for 2-3 minutes, stirring constantly until the sauce thickens and becomes glossy.
- Cool and Serve: Remove sauce from heat and allow to cool. The sauce will continue to thicken as it cools. Serve warm or at room temperature, garnished with fresh cilantro.
Notes
Store the sauce in an airtight container in the refrigerator for up to 2 weeks or freeze for up to 3 months. To make it low-carb, substitute granulated sugar with a 1:1 ratio of monk fruit or erythritol. For extra flavor, add a squeeze of fresh lime juice after taking the sauce off the heat.
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Category: Condiment
- Method: Roast, Simmer
- Cuisine: Asian
Nutrition
- Serving Size: 2 tablespoons
- Calories: 40 kcal
- Sugar: 9 g
- Sodium: 120 mg
- Fat: 0 g
- Saturated Fat: 0 g
- Unsaturated Fat: 0 g
- Trans Fat: 0 g
- Carbohydrates: 12 g
- Fiber: 0 g
- Protein: 0 g
- Cholesterol: 0 mg
Keywords: sweet chili sauce, homemade sauce, dipping sauce, condiment, roasted pepper sauce, asian sauce, spicy, vegetarian, vegan option




